THE EASTSIDE REVIEW- ON RAMPART LABEL, A LEGENDARY EAST LOS ANGELES DOUBLE LP OF 60's INDY/GARAGE BAND GROUPS -- (LP) ONE IS Chicano rock /60's garage/northern Rnb stompers..with ballads on the flips

and LP(2) Is mostly the same Chicano groups as on the dancer lp,...but sprinkled with some midtempo things & a few other Indie bands which are not on LP one..just Killer and classic east Los Angeles slice of 60's garage INDIE group history here on wax....although this double LP I have is the 2nd issue which is pressed on clearwax it is still very very rare!!, as the 1st issue was pressed on multicolored wax, and the third and last issue pressed on black vinyl.....overall I grade the cover overall Vg with slightly tathered top corners. With halfway splits on top and bottom but in tact! the vinyl and labels look Vg++ but play with some surface noise throughout as all known copies do!!
